Output 0467960b45536b20d36352f794085af21d0018f69d26f6877df486197d251b3f:1

value
7608121565
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f511a4dedd7754ea9636a8d938df06e7fec2eb2407b1336351e35b622c2c09ea
address
tb1p75g6fhkawa2w493k4rvn3hcxullv96eyq7cnxc63uddkytpvp84q69swmw
transaction
0467960b45536b20d36352f794085af21d0018f69d26f6877df486197d251b3f
confirmations
78415
spent
true